I discovered in bug 1656689, comment 16 that the iframe that the mochitest harness uses to run tests in has scrolling="no" set on it, here
This is different from almost every other document that we ever see, so we shouldn't be doing this for tests.
One place this effects is ScrollFrameHelper::GetScrollStylesFromFrame
I noticed the same thing about the mochitest-chrome harness in bug 1199023, but this uses an unusual way to add scrolling=no that would be hard to search for.
I tried to look up the history for this, it seems to be back to 2007 when the mochitest harness was added.
We fail a handful of tests when this is removed that will have to be fixed in order to fix this
